The RGB color code for color number #B69B98 is RGB(182, 155, 152). In the RGB color model, #B69B98 has a red value of 182, a green value of 155, and a blue value of 152.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 14.8% magenta, 16.5% yellow, and 28.6%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 6° (degrees), 17.0 % saturation, and 65.5 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#B69B98 has a hue of 6° (degrees), 16.5 % saturation and 71.4 % brightness/value.
Color B69B98 is cool or warm?
Color B69B98 is a warm color.
What is the LRV of B69B98?
Color code B69B98 has an LRV of nearly 36.
By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
